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E) MCP server -- scan, connect and interact with BLE peripherals

Blew MCP server allows AI tools and agents to scan for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E) devices, connect to them, read the GATT tree and characteristics, read/write characteristics values and more. It's useful when developing BLE devices or doing security research/reverse engineering. Main features: * Scan for BLE devices with filtering by name, service UUID, RSSI, manufacturer * Connect to devices and walk the full GATT tree (services, characteristics, descriptors) * Read and write characteristic values with automatic format detection * Subscribe to notifications and collect batches * Look up Bluetooth SIG specs for any characteristic UUID * Spin up a BLE peripheral and advertise custom services from your Mac * Clone a real device's GATT structure and impersonate it * Push value updates and notify connected subscribers
